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$3,335 in Puyallup, WA versus $3,114 in Denver, CO.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$4,348 in Puyallup, WA versus $4,663 in Denver, CO.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$5,361 in Puyallup, WA versus $6,212 in Denver, CO.

Living in Puyallup, WA is roughly 7% more expensive than Denver, CO, driven mainly by Getting Around.

Both cities are pricier than the global median: Puyallup, WA 149% above, Denver, CO 133% above.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,831 in Puyallup, WA and $2,120 in Denver, CO.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Puyallup, WA pays 47%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$72.0 in Puyallup, WA vs $84.0 in Denver, CO. Groceries flip the comparison at $504 vs $451, with Denver, CO cheaper for home cooking.
